国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 辦公 > WPS > 正文

巧用WPS表格提取身份證個人信息

2024-08-23 07:19:43
字體:
來源:轉載
供稿:網友

一、文章簡介:

  本文主要向讀者介紹如何利用wps表格的函數功能,根據個人身份證號,一勞永逸地提取出生日期、性別等個人信息,實現個人信息的自動錄入。

二、巧用WPS函數功能

  最近,單位需要上報人事局一份職工信息,其中既有個人身份證號,又有出生日期、性別等信息。由于人員眾多,輸入確實麻煩,而且容易出錯,弄不好還得返工。能不能有個一個一勞永逸的辦法,又快又準地錄入出生日期、性別等個人信息呢?能!因為身份證號中包含這些個人信息,大家使用WPS表格可以輕松地提取些個人信息,以實現自動錄入,從而又快又準地完成工作。

  目前,中國的身份證號分為兩種,一種為15位, 一種為18位。在15位的老版身份證中,第7到12位為出生日期數,最后一位為性別代碼,偶數為女,奇數為男。18位的新身份證中第7到14位為出生日期數,倒數第2位為性別代碼,同樣偶數為女,奇數為男。

  基于這個特點,大家可以用函數加以判斷。如圖1是已輸入完身份證號的職工信息表,在輸入身份證號時需注意,要把單元格格式設為文本型,或在所輸身份證號前加一個單引號“'”。

在wps表格中輸入身份證號

圖1 在wps表格中輸入身份證號

1、提取出生日期

  在D2中輸入公式“=IF(LEN(C2)=15,TEXT(MID(C2,7,6),"1900年00月00日"),TEXT(MID(C2,7,8),"00年00月00日"))”,拖動填充柄向下復制公式,這樣就完成了出生日期的提取(如圖2):

巧用wps提取出生日期

圖2 巧用wps提取出生日期

2、提取性別信息

  在E2中輸入公式“=IF(MOD(IF(LEN(C2)=15,MID(C2,15,1),MID(C2,17,1)),2)=1,"男","女")”,拖動填充柄向下復制公式,這樣就完成了性別信息的提取(如圖3):

用WPS表格提取性別信息

圖3 用WPS表格提取性別信息

  公式詳解:LEN是長度函數,MID是提取字符函數,TEXT是轉換格式函數,MOD是整除函數,IF是判斷函數。提取出生日期公式的意思是如果身份證號為15位,把從第7位起的6個字符轉換為"1900年00月00日"的格式,否則(即為18位身份 證),把從第7位起的8個字符轉換為"00年00月00日"的格式。提取性別信息公式的意思是如果身份證號為15位,把第15位和2整除,如果整除,顯示為女,不能整除,顯示為男;身份證號為18位,把第15位和2整除,如果整除,顯示為女,不能整除,顯示為男。另外,如果想把出生日期轉換為真正的日期類型,只需在公式中在TEXT前加兩個減號,這是減負運算,然后根據需要設置單元格具體的日期類型。

  以上只是在身份證錄入正確的情況下設置的,如果身份證號錄入錯誤,如位數不對,日期信息不對(如月分數超過了12,日數出現2月有31號的情況),怎么辦呢?還是留給大家思考吧!要學會舉一反三喲。 


發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 陆丰市| 和平区| 六枝特区| 河东区| 沈丘县| 托克逊县| 南京市| 高雄市| 慈利县| 孝感市| 霍山县| 津南区| 东港市| 琼结县| 阿坝县| 中宁县| 祁门县| 雷州市| 常宁市| 临潭县| 济宁市| 龙山县| 睢宁县| 婺源县| 盱眙县| 怀柔区| 贵定县| 阿尔山市| 通州区| 郯城县| 高阳县| 正镶白旗| 会同县| 吴堡县| 嘉义县| 灵石县| 晋宁县| 左云县| 太谷县| 湖南省| 达拉特旗|